Title

RECONSTRUCTION OF KUHBANAN FAULT SYSTEM SINCE LATE PLIOCENE, WEST OF BAHABAD, CENTRAL IRAN

Pages

  111-126

Abstract

 Kuhbanan fault system, as one of the intercontinental faults of central Iran, is recognized by considerable seismogenic activities and modem morphotectonics evidences with a strike-slip (reverse component) motion. According to the geometric and kinematics data, Kuhbanan fault has been divided into 5 segments (S26, S27, S28, S29, S30) in Bahabad region. Measured GEOMORPHIC INDICES of ratio of valley-floor width to valley height (Vf) and morphology of the valley (V) manifest the maximum denudation rate for the S28segment. The mean calculated values of mountain-front sinuosity (Smf) and %facet parameters for different segments of the fault are 1.1 and 83.16, consequently. Regarding to these GEOMORPHIC INDICES, a denudation rate of about 2-4 mmyr-1 is suggested for this region.According to reconstruction of Kuhbanan fault since 360 ka, minimum horizontal CUMULATIVE DISPLACEMENT of 750 m and minimum SLIP RATE of about 2-1.4±0.1mmyr-1 is inferred from well preserved geomorphology in the northern segment of the fault. Applying this horizontal CUMULATIVE DISPLACEMENT causes reconstruction of geomorphic markers such as drainages and shuttered ridges.
